Millennium Challenge Corporation (MCC), a United States government agency designed to work with developing countries, is based on the principle that aid is most effective when it reinforces good governance, economic freedom, and investments in people that promote economic growth and help eliminate extreme poverty. 45 | VideoLesotho Health Clinics | About 23 percent of Lesotho’s population is infected with HIV/AIDS, one of the highest prevalence rates in the world. In response, MCC has invested $122 million in health infrastructure and to strengthen Lesotho’s health systems. A major portion of the Health Sector Project focuses on rehabilitating 138 health centers across the country, all of which play a pivotal role in providing primary health care to local communities. MCC’s investments leverage those from other donor and U.S. Government programs, including the President’s Emergency Plan For AIDS Relief, the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, and the Global Fund to Fight AIDS, Tuberculosis and Malaria. Program officer Marcel Ricou shows us how MCC and the Government of Lesotho are working together to combat HIV/AIDS. | 11/30/2012 | Free | View in iTunes |

58 | VideoPutting Principles into Practice: Lessons from MCC on Country Ownership | Watch a discussion about country ownership with MCC and Oxfam America: How effective has it been, what lessons have we learned, and what do partner countries have to say about it? Country ownership is a core principle of MCC’s approach to development. MCC partner countries exercise country ownership when governments, in close consultation with citizens, take the lead in setting priorities for MCC investments, implementing MCC-funded programs, and being accountable to domestic stakeholders for both making decisions and achieving results. | 12/13/2011 | Free | View in iTunes |
